作为人工智能的前沿技术,强化学习被广泛应用于各个领域。而要掌握强化学习,最好的方式莫过于通过实践。OpenAI Gym作为一款强化学习的工具包,为开发人员提供了一系列的模拟环境,帮助他们快速搭建强化学习实验环境。
OpenAI Gym提供了大量的预定义环境,比如经典的游戏场景、“小车赛道”和各种控制问题等。这些环境都有相应的目标和奖励机制,开发人员可以通过定义智能体来与环境进行互动,使其通过试错学习来达到最佳策略。通过这种方式,您可以深入理解强化学习的原理和算法,并进行个性化的扩展和优化。
使用OpenAI Gym非常方便。您需要安装OpenAI Gym库,然后通过导入库文件,就可以在Python中使用Gym的功能。通过Gym的接口,您可以轻松地进行训练和实验。具体而言,您可以使用Gym提供的命令来初始化环境、获取环境的状态和动作空间、与环境进行交互等。这些命令的灵活性使得使用OpenAI Gym变得非常便捷。
在使用OpenAI Gym时,一个核心概念是智能体(Agent)。智能体是指与环境进行交互并采取行动的实体。智能体通过观察环境的状态,选择最佳策略并执行相应的动作。环境会根据智能体的动作返回奖励或反馈信息,智能体需要通过试错学习来优化自己的策略。这个过程就是强化学习的核心。
OpenAI Gym还提供了丰富的工具和资源,帮助您更好地理解和应用强化学习。例如,Gym提供了可视化界面,可以展示智能体在环境中的行为和学习过程,帮助您更直观地观察和分析实验结果。Gym还提供了大量的示例代码和教程,供用户参考和学习。您可以通过这些资源,快速上手强化学习,提高自己的技能。
无论您是新手还是专家,OpenAI Gym都是一个非常有用的工具。对于新手OpenAI Gym提供了简单易用的接口,帮助他们快速入门并理解强化学习的基本概念。对于专家OpenAI Gym提供了丰富的环境和资源,可以支持更复杂和深入的研究与开发。
OpenAI Gym为开发人员提供了极其便利的强化学习开发环境。通过使用OpenAI Gym,您可以更加高效地进行强化学习的实践和探索。无论您是想要进一步研究人工智能,还是应用强化学习解决实际问题,OpenAI Gym都是您不可或缺的助力。快来使用OpenAI Gym,成为AI大师的第一步!
147SEO » 成为AI大师的第一步:OpenAI Gym教程